Fantastic shot! This, though, is a Lincoln's Sparrow. The Swamp Sparrow wouldn't have the streaking that you see here, plus it would have more yellow on the bill. The wings on the Swamp Sparrow would also be solidly rufous, not the streaks as on this bird. This, along with a few other marks, and the fact that a Swamp Sparrow would be pretty rare in Arizona, make this a Lincoln's Sparrow. Great shot nonetheless!
